Title 24 roof shingles refers to the California Energy Code requirements for roofing materials and assemblies aimed at reducing building cooling loads. This article explains what Title 24 requires, how asphalt shingles and other roofing options can comply, performance metrics to consider, and practical steps for homeowners and contractors seeking compliance. Focus is on practical compliance paths, product selection, and real-world installation tips.

What Title 24 Requires For Roofs
Title 24 sets energy efficiency standards for buildings in California, including roofs, to reduce heat gain and cooling energy. For roofs, the code uses metrics like Solar Reflectance Index (SRI), solar reflectance, and thermal emittance to define cool roof performance. Requirements vary by climate zone, building type, and whether the roof is low-slope or steep-slope.
Key Metrics: Solar Reflectance, Thermal Emittance, And SRI
Solar reflectance measures the fraction of solar energy reflected by a surface; higher values mean less absorbed heat. Thermal emittance measures the ability to radiate absorbed heat to the sky or atmosphere. Solar Reflectance Index (SRI) combines both numbers to represent overall cool roof performance.
Steep-Slope Vs Low-Slope Requirements
Title 24 distinguishes steep-slope roofs (typically >2:12) from low-slope roofs, with different prescriptive thresholds. Steep-slope asphalt shingles can meet code with moderate reflectance, while low-slope roofs generally require higher reflectance or specialized materials. Many residential roofs are steep-slope, where cool shingle products are widely available.
Prescriptive Compliance With Cool Shingles
Under the prescriptive path, roofs must meet minimum SRI or reflectance values listed in the code by climate zone. Manufacturers supply rated values on product data sheets; choosing shingles with certified reflectance/emittance simplifies compliance. The prescriptive path is the most straightforward for single-family homes.
Performance Compliance And Energy Modeling
The performance pathway allows flexibility by using whole-building energy modeling to show that the proposed design meets or exceeds the code’s energy budget. This path is useful when architectural or material choices prevent meeting prescriptive values, or when compensating measures (insulation, HVAC efficiency) are used.CF1R/CF2R forms are required documentation for the performance path.

Cool Asphalt Shingles: How They Work
Cool asphalt shingles incorporate reflective granules or surface treatments to increase solar reflectance while maintaining typical shingle aesthetics. These shingles reduce rooftop temperatures, lower attic heat gain, and can improve indoor comfort and HVAC efficiency.They are available in a range of colors, though darker shades typically offer lower reflectance.
Choosing Shingle Colors And Materials
Color significantly affects reflectance; light colors reflect more solar energy, but modern cool-color technologies allow darker hues to achieve higher reflectance than traditional dark shingles. Comparing manufacturer-rated reflectance/emittance data is essential when selecting materials for Title 24 compliance.
Installation Details That Affect Performance
Proper installation influences actual roof performance. Ventilation, attic insulation, underlayment, and roof slope all affect heat transfer; poor installation can negate the benefits of cool shingles.Ensuring adequate ridge and soffit ventilation and sealing attic penetrations is critical.
Documentation And Verification For Title 24
Compliance requires documentation: product data sheets with certified reflectance and emittance values, CF1R/CF2R forms for performance paths, and installation details. Energy consultants or certified HERS raters often assist with modeling and field verification to ensure the installed roof matches the documented specification.
Cost Considerations And Energy Savings
Cool shingles often carry a price premium over standard shingles, but savings come from reduced cooling loads and extended roof lifespan in some climates. Payback depends on local climate, attic insulation, HVAC efficiency, and electricity rates; in hot inland regions, payback can be faster due to larger cooling savings.
When Alternatives Are More Practical
If cool shingles cannot meet prescriptive thresholds, alternatives include increasing attic insulation, improving HVAC efficiency, adding radiant barriers, or using performance compliance. Sometimes a combined approach (moderately reflective shingles plus ventilation and insulation upgrades) is the most cost-effective path to Title 24 compliance.
Impact On Roof Longevity And Maintenance
Higher reflectance can reduce thermal cycling and UV degradation, potentially extending shingle life. However, maintenance such as gutter cleaning and moss prevention remains necessary; reflective granules do not eliminate the need for routine roof care.

Local Climate And Urban Heat Island Considerations
Title 24 recognizes climate zone differences; coastal zones have different thresholds than hot inland zones. Using cool roofing on a neighborhood scale can also reduce urban heat island effects and lower community-wide cooling loads.Municipal incentives or local building programs may encourage cool roof adoption.

Common Misconceptions About Cool Shingles
Some assume cool roofs are only white or that they cause winter heating penalties. Modern cool-color shingles offer a range of colors, and winter heating penalties in most U.S. climates are minimal compared to summer cooling savings in hot regions.Decisions should be climate-based and modeled when in doubt.
How To Confirm Product Ratings
Verify manufacturer claims through independent test reports (e.g., CRRC – Cool Roof Rating Council), product technical sheets, and Title 24 documentation. Look for products with certified SRI or CRRC ratings and ensure the values correspond to the installed product color and configuration.
Practical Steps For Homeowners And Contractors
Homeowners should request manufacturer data sheets, confirm CF1R/CF2R requirements with their contractor, and consider a pre-installation energy consultation. Contractors should keep sample product documentation, ensure proper attic ventilation/insulation, and coordinate with energy modelers or HERS raters as needed.
Case Studies And Real-World Outcomes
Studies in hot climates show cool roofs can reduce attic temperatures by 20–30°F and lower peak cooling loads substantially. Real-world monitoring indicates meaningful energy savings when cool shingles are paired with proper attic insulation and ventilation.Results vary by climate and building design.
Future Trends: Materials And Regulations
Advances in granule coatings, cool-color pigments, and reflective polymer membranes continue to improve dark-color reflectance. Regulatory trends in California emphasize lifecycle energy performance, so product innovation and integrated building solutions will play an increasing role in meeting Title 24 goals.
